Prevalence of Meth Addiction:
Meth addiction is an increasing issue that affects folks of all ages and experiences. In line with the 2019 National research on Drug Use and wellness (NSDUH), around 1.6 million men and women in america reported utilizing methamphetamine before year, indicating the widespread nature of this issue. Also, the un workplace on medication and Crime estimates that around 26 million individuals globally used methamphetamines at least once within their lifetime.
Reasons and Risk Factors:
Several factors play a role in the introduction of meth addiction. Included in these are genetic predisposition, environmental elements, and private situations. Analysis suggests that those with a household history of addiction might even more at risk of establishing a methamphetamine dependency. Also, injury, abuse, neglect, and an unstable residence environment can increase the possibility of addiction. Additionally, utilizing meth in social groups or as a way to cope with tension or psychological pain may more play a role in the introduction of addiction.
Results of Meth Addiction:
Meth addiction have severe physical, psychological, and personal effects. The medication promotes the release of dopamine, a neurotransmitter connected with enjoyment and reward, ultimately causing intense emotions of euphoria. However, prolonged usage rewires mental performance, resulting in an elevated threshold and consequently bigger amounts to ultimately achieve the desired result. This period of escalating usage can very quickly result in addiction.
Physical consequences of meth addiction consist of severe weight-loss, dental issues (often called "meth mouth"), skin sores, and cardio dilemmas. Psychologically, meth addiction can induce paranoia, hallucinations, anxiety, hostility, and psychosis. Moreover, long-lasting usage can result in cognitive impairments, loss of memory, and changes in engine features.
The personal influence of meth addiction is profound, influencing people, communities, and culture most importantly. Dilemmas such tense relationships, unemployment, financial struggles, unlawful behavior, and spread of infectious conditions (e.g., HIV/AIDS) in many cases are associated with meth addiction. Treatment Options:
Treating meth addiction requires a comprehensive strategy that encompasses both physical and psychological aspects. Effective therapy can sometimes include a combination of behavioral treatments, counseling, support groups, and medication-assisted therapy. Cognitive-behavioral therapy (CBT) is commonly employed to help people recognize and change their particular harmful thoughts and habits about medicine use. Also, medications eg bupropion and naltrexone may facilitate reducing cravings and managing withdrawal symptoms.
